#e4c881 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e4c881 is composed of 89.4% red, 78.4%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.3% magenta, 43.4%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 43 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 70%. #e4c881 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c99103.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#e4c881 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e4c881 has RGB values of R:228, G:200,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.43,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14993537.

Shades and Tints of #e4c881

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f2 is the lightest one.
